Current Bitcoin (BTC) trading strategies are presenting compelling opportunities by leveraging Fibonacci retracement levels and deep market liquidity analysis. Following the recent push toward the psychological $79,000 mark, the market has entered a healthy correction phase aimed at filling the Fair Value Gap (FVG) on the 4-hour timeframe. Technically, the $74,500 level serves as a crucial pivot point, representing a confluence between the 50 EMA and the 0.618 Fibonacci level—a zone where "whales" frequently re-accumulate. Furthermore, the daily RSI cooling down from overbought territory toward the 55 neutral level suggests that selling pressure is stabilizing, granting the price enough breathing room to consolidate before attempting a breakout above $80.000.
An effective trading plan involves initiating long positions on the pullback within the $74,800 to $75,200 range, supported by strict risk management. The primary take-profit target is set at the local resistance of $78,500, while a secondary target rests at the 1.272 Fibonacci extension near $81,200. It is vital for traders to place a stop loss below $72,900 to protect against a potential reversal of the bullish structure if the price closes below this support. Given the persistent institutional inflows through ETFs, waiting for the "Golden Pocket" offers a significantly more optimal Risk-to-Reward ratio than chasing the top due to FOMO.
